Rez writes: > > Does cvs by default use the /tmp directory to keep track of locked files?
No. By default, it puts the lock files in the repository with the RCS files. > Where's this directive set, in what file, should I tell cvs to direct > to another directory, /etc/inetd.conf? Which directive? The lock file location can be set with the LockDir= keyword in the $CVSROOT/CVSROOT/config file. The temp file directory can be set by adding the -T option to the server command options in [x]inetd.conf or by setting $TMPDIR in the server's environment. -- Larry Jones I wonder if I can grow fangs when my baby teeth fall out. -- Calvin
